High Point, NC -- Police in High Point were on the scene of a standoff they say started with a domestic dispute.

The incident happened at 105 Charles Ave.

Police said when they arrived on a domestic dispute call, they could not get the suspect to respond or come outside. The department activated its SWAT team to help with the situation.

They later found Eliezier Montanez Nazario was holding his estranged wife hostage in her home.

Negotiators arrived on the scene and successfully ended the standoff.

Nazario was arrested at the scene and charged with Violation of Domestic Violence Protective Order with a Deadly Weapon, Possession of Stolen Firearm, Felony Breaking and Entering, Assault with a Deadly Weapon Inflicting Serious Injury, and First-Degree Kidnapping.

The victim was transported to a local hospital where she is being treated for non-life-threatening injuries.
